What Should You Check Before Using a Bouncy Castle?

Setting up a bouncy castle is only part of the process.

Before children begin playing, it is important to carry out a few simple checks to help ensure the inflatable is being used safely and correctly.

Whether you’re organizing a birthday party, school event, community gathering, or corporate function, spending a few minutes on a pre-use inspection can help prevent unnecessary problems and create a better experience for everyone involved.

Here are some of the most important things to check before using a bouncy castle.

1. Is the Inflatable Fully Inflated?

Before participants enter the inflatable, make sure the bouncy castle has reached its proper shape and firmness.

A fully inflated unit should appear stable, upright, and evenly pressurized.

If the inflatable appears soft or partially inflated, the blower or air connections should be checked.

2. Are All Anchor Points Secure?

Proper anchoring is one of the most important safety requirements.

Check that all stakes, sandbags, or ballast systems are correctly positioned and firmly secured.

Never use a commercial inflatable without following the recommended anchoring procedures.

3. Is the Blower Working Correctly?

The blower should operate continuously while the inflatable is in use.

Before allowing participants to enter, confirm that:

  • The blower is connected securely
  • Air tubes are properly attached
  • Power cables are undamaged
  • Airflow is unobstructed

A properly functioning blower is essential for safe operation.

4. Is the Setup Area Clear?

Inspect the surrounding area carefully.

Remove any objects that could create hazards, including:

  • Sharp objects
  • Rocks
  • Tree branches
  • Outdoor furniture
  • Other obstacles

A clear setup area helps reduce the risk of accidents.

5. Are the Weather Conditions Suitable?

Weather should always be considered before operating a bouncy castle outdoors.

Strong winds, storms, and severe weather conditions can affect safe operation.

If conditions change during an event, the inflatable should be monitored closely and operated according to the manufacturer’s guidelines.

6. Are Entrances and Exits Clear?

Participants should be able to enter and exit the inflatable safely.

Check that entrances and exits are unobstructed and that any required safety mats are correctly positioned.

Good access helps improve both safety and supervision.

7. Is Appropriate Supervision Available?

Adult supervision is essential whenever a bouncy castle is being used.

Supervisors can help:

  • Monitor participant behavior
  • Prevent overcrowding
  • Enforce safety rules
  • Respond quickly if problems occur

Good supervision contributes significantly to a safe and enjoyable experience.

8. Are Participants Following the Rules?

Before play begins, it is helpful to explain any basic safety rules.

Simple reminders about taking turns, avoiding rough play, and using the inflatable responsibly can help reduce the likelihood of injuries.
